Understanding the UK Driving License
A UK [Driving Licence](https://posteezy.com/20-trailblazers-leading-way-uk-driving-licence-1) license functions as both legal authorization to drive and a main type of identification. The Driver and Vehicle Licensing Agency (DVLA) handles the licensing system across England, Scotland, and Wales, while the Driver and Vehicle Agency (DVA) deals with matters in Northern Ireland. Together, these companies ensure that all motorists fulfill the essential medical and practical standards before giving license advantages.

The modern-day UK driving license is a photocard license, presented in 1998 to enhance security and reduce fraud. This credit-card-sized document contains the holder's photograph, personal details, and details about the vehicles they are permitted to drive. License holders should renew their photocard every ten years, though the connected driving entitlements stay valid until they expire, normally when the holder reaches age 70.
Kinds Of UK Driving Licenses
The UK licensing system identifies in between numerous kinds of licenses, each developed to attend to various driving circumstances and experience levels.

Provisional License

The provisionary license represents the first stage for brand-new chauffeurs in the UK. Individuals can request a provisionary license from the age of 15 years and 9 months, though they can not really drive on public roads until they reach 17. The provisional license enforces certain limitations, most significantly the requirement that all driving must be supervised by a certified driver who has actually held a full license for a minimum of 3 years. Provisionary license holders face extra limitations, including a prohibition on driving on motorways and showing 'L' plates prominently on their lorry.

Complete License

After effectively finishing the useful driving test, prospects receive a complete UK driving license. This license grants holders the opportunity of driving without supervision, offered they comply with all roadway traffic regulations and keep the license's credibility. The complete license remains valid till the holder reaches 70 years of age, after which renewal durations reduce to every 3 years.

International Driving Permit

Visitors from certain nations may drive in the UK using an International Driving Permit (IDP) alongside their valid foreign license. The IDP translates the holder's driving credentials into numerous languages and is acknowledged under international arrangements. Nevertheless, IDP validity durations and accepted countries go through specific terms that visitors ought to validate before arrival.

The Application Process
Requesting a UK driving license includes numerous stages that DVLA has streamlined through online and postal choices. The process normally follows a constant pattern regardless of whether applicants seek their very first license or add new classifications to an existing one.

The preliminary application needs applicants to offer identity documents, pass a theory test, show useful driving capability, and pay the appropriate charges. For novice candidates, the journey normally starts with acquiring a provisional license, which can be finished online through the DVLA site or by sending a D1 type available at Post Office locations. Applicants must declare any medical conditions that might impact their driving capability and provide a passport-standard photo.

The theory test makes up 2 elements: multiple-choice questions on highway code understanding and threat understanding. Candidates must pass both components at the same sitting to proceed to the practical driving test. Renewals and License Updates
Keeping a UK driving license existing requires attention to expiration dates and prompt updates when situations alter. License holders should inform DVLA of any changes to their name, address, or medical condition within a defined timeframe, usually 28 days for address modifications and immediately for medical updates that could affect driving security.

Photocard license renewals can be completed online beginning with 90 days before expiration. The process needs a digital picture, which applicants can provide by submitting a recent image or licensing DVLA to utilize an existing passport picture. The present renewal charge applies, and the brand-new photocard will display an upgraded expiration date while maintaining the initial license issue date for continuity functions.

Chauffeurs over 70 face different renewal procedures, with totally free license extensions readily available every three years. These renewals consist of a self-declaration of health, though drivers should instantly report any medical conditions that could hinder their driving ability regardless of when their license is due for renewal.

Can I drive in the UK with a foreign license?

Visitors and new homeowners can drive utilizing their legitimate foreign license for approximately 12 months from getting in the UK. After this period, license exchange or full UK testing ends up being needed. People from particular nations can exchange their license without taking theory or dry runs, while others should complete the complete UK testing process.

What happens if I lose my driving license?

Lost or taken licenses can be replaced through the DVLA website for a charge. Applicants should declare the loss and offer supporting identification. The replacement license will show the exact same license number and privileges as the original, maintaining the original concern date for continuity functions.

Do points on my license impact my insurance?

Penalty points stay on a driving record for 4 or 5 years depending upon the offense, and insurance suppliers typically ask applicants to state any points when seeking coverage. While not all points result in license revocation, built up points can affect insurance premiums and might activate revocation proceedings for serious or repetitive offenses.
